Governor Radda Discharged from Hospital After Road Accident

Katsina, Nigeria – The Katsina State Government has confirmed that Governor Dikko Umaru Radda has been discharged from the hospital following a minor road accident that occurred on Sunday evening along the Daura–Katsina Road.

Bashir Ahmad, a former aide to the late President Muhammadu Buhari, relayed the update via social media, quoting the Chairman of Katsina Local Government as confirming the governor’s release from the medical facility.

Earlier, the governor’s Chief Press Secretary, Ibrahim Kaula Mohammed, had described the incident as a “minor crash” and assured the public that Governor Radda was in stable condition and receiving appropriate care.

The government has expressed gratitude for the outpouring of concern and well-wishes from the public, reaffirming the governor’s commitment to continue discharging his duties.
